Welcome

The Madill Alumni Educational Foundation is proud to offer a variety of scholarships to graduating high school seniors and now former graduates of Madill High School. 

SCHOLARSHIPs available

GRADUATING SENIORS

ELIGIBILITY & REQUIREMENTS

  • 2026 MHS candidate for graduation

  • Complete scholarship application and include all required attachments.

  • Attend Meet & Greet session with Madill Alumni Educational Foundation held in the MHS Library and scheduled following scholarship application submission.

  • Attend the 2026 Madill Alumni Banquet.

  • Enroll in and attend an accredited higher educational institution for both the Fall 2026 and Spring 2027 semesters.

  • Maintain full-time student status and a minimum GPA of 3.0.

SCHOLARSHIPS

  • Rex & Billye Herndon Memorial Scholarship

    • $1,500​

    • Awarded to a student who has shown proficiency in mathematics.

  • Pate Family Memorial Scholarship

    • $1,500​

    • Awarded to a student who has shown proficiency in journalism.

  • Herschel Beard Memorial Scholarship

    • $2,000​

    • Awarded to a student who has demonstrated academic excellence and community involvement.

  • Brandon Jacks Memorial Scholarship

    • $2,000​

    • Awarded to one or more students who have demonstrated academic excellence and who display the qualities of Mr. Wildcat:  optimistic, joyful, unique.

  • MHS Class of 1976 Memorial Trades Scholarship

    • Amount to be determined.​

    • Awarded to one or more students who aspire to obtain a degree or certification in the Trades.

  • MHS Scholarships

    • $2,000/each

    • Awarded to two male and two female students who demonstrate academic excellence and financial need.

MHS ALUMNI

ELIGIBILITY & REQUIREMENTS

  • MHS Graduate

  • Complete scholarship application and include all required attachments.

  • Attend Meet & Greet session with Madill Alumni Educational Foundation scheduled following scholarship application submission.  Virtual option available.

  • Attend the 2026 Madill Alumni Banquet.

  • Completed at least one year at an accredited higher educational institution.

  • Enroll in and attend an accredited higher educational institution for both the Fall 2026 and Spring 2027 semesters.

  • Maintain full-time student status and a minimum GPA of 3.0.

SCHOLARSHIP

  • William C. Chapman Family Scholarship

    • $2,500​

    • Awarded to a student who has demonstrated academic excellence and financial need.

Application period opens February 1, 2026

 

DEADLINE: MARCH 31, 2026
